Anne Mathieu is a scholar working on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Applied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Anne Mathieu has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 362 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, 4 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ics and 4 papers in Applied Psychology. Recurrent topics in Anne Mathieu's work include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(6 papers),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(4 papers) and Coaching Methods and Impact (3 papers). Anne Mathieu is often cited by papers focused on Job Satisfaction and Organizational Behavior (6 papers),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(4 papers) and Coaching Methods and Impact (3 papers). Anne Mathieu collaborates with scholars based in Canada, France and Belgium. Anne Mathieu's co-authors include Jacques Lasseur, Alexandre Joannon, M. R. Merrifield, Konrad Kuijken, Norman T. Bruvold, P. Neal Ritchey, Itamar Simonson, Frank R. Kardes, David C. Houghton and Sadrudin A. Ahmed and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Monthly Notices of the Royal Astronomical Society and Environmental Science & Policy.
